India became sovereign democratic republic at 10.30 am on 26th January 1950, with the inauguration of the constitution. India’s last governor general, C Raja gopal achari, read the proclamation announcing the birth of new republic.

The election of 1999 has proved that the voters won’t accept any idea of toppling a democratic government without any concrete reason there by reinstalling Mr. Atal bihari vajpawee as the priminister of India. The elections of 14th lok sabha have surprised everybody. The much advertiser’s the “India shining”, and “feel good factor” were thrown to dustbin by the electorate and again the congress was given mandate to form the government.
